Publisher's Summary:
This book explores the concept of abstraction as both a central method of philosophical inquiry and a process that inevitably encounters multiple forms of limitation. Through logical, epistemological, ontological, linguistic, existential, and mystical perspectives, it examines how abstraction can clarify, distort, transcend, or collapse into self-reference and emptiness. It argues that while abstraction is essential for conceptual thought, it also risks severing ties with lived experience, language, and meaning.
